UMMB

That's urea molasses mineral block (aka UMMB) which is a good supplement for cattle. It can be used as lick or it can be dissolved in the drinking water. I tried making some but the mixture from the formula I got from an FAO document was dificult to harden.

It contains urea, molasses, minerals, tricalcium phosphate, cement, salt, and rice bran. The formula did not mention adding water but without water the resulting mixture was very dry. So
I added some to properly mix the materials. Next time, I'll decrease the amount of water.
